Output 84c250263fce0fa6ced4b68dc867afa4b14c62e23bc094ef14780f044bae3660:0

value
72805394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ec99da9d2e950677f488e8461ec2160337a1da97 OP_EQUAL
address
3PG3hmysjLEs9CgVhUG1HGgpwWKaJ5AjZC
transaction
84c250263fce0fa6ced4b68dc867afa4b14c62e23bc094ef14780f044bae3660
spent
true